Nla Lake is a productive, nutrient-rich eutrophic lake in Leavenworth County, Kansas. Water quality is graded C based on 2 sampling years through 2017. Compared to the 1 other monitored lakes in Leavenworth County, Nla Lake ranks #2 for water quality.
Source: EPA Water Quality Portal sampling records, Kansas DNR, last sampled 2017-06-22. Grade methodology: LakeGrade methodology.

Water Quality Grade: C, Fair
Very murky, less than 3.2 ft of visibility. Phosphorus level: 67.2 µg/L. Chlorophyll-a: 11.7 µg/L. Trophic State Index: 60.
| Metric | Value | Grade |
|---|---|---|
| Water Clarity (Secchi Depth) | 3.2 ft | D |
| Phosphorus | 67.2 µg/L | D |
| Chlorophyll-a (Algae) | 11.7 µg/L | C |
| Trophic State Index (TSI) | 60 | Eutrophic |
High nutrients, frequent algae, reduced clarity
